A year ago, I would've ... 1) do a normal atDNA test with AncestryDNA, since their DNA results seems the most "generic" (easily copy-able to all of GEDmatch, MyHeritage, and FTDNA), and then 2) download my AncestryDNA spit kits results, and upload them to Promethease for USD12. ... and that's still what I'd do now, but I haven't done it for a year so I haven't checked right now to see whether "it's the same as it used to be" (which was good--much like "the old 23andMe" except not nearly as polished). I believe that only 23andme offers testing on health issues And 23andme is strictly limited to specific health issues. Remember that 23andme was shut down and put out of business for many months because the Food and Drug Administration said they did not have a license to practice medicine. After tremendous objections 23andme was allowed to reopen on Family Tree and genealogy issues. Now after litigation against the FDA they have offered tests on just a few rare conditions which your friend probably does not have. Hi Marleen, Best is to do a Full Genome Sequencing as the number of health related SNP’s is limited with 23andMe to those that they targeted first. FTDNA doesn’t test health, so you can’t even get the APO-E for Alzheimer with them. Ancestry has started to check some but that’s also way more limited than 23andMe as it’s mainly some traits. I'd like to share my experience with Dante Labs (see also this post https://www.wikitree.com/g2g/719230/a-30x-full-genome-sequence-for-199-169-150 ) so that everyone can make an informed decision if you want to buy from this company or not as they are running another promotion right now. On the 18th of November I've order their Black Friday offer which is described above. Please note that I was one of the first to order as I saw their advertisement about a Black Friday offer with a countdown of a several hours on their website. I've received their confirmation email immediately. Others including Edison Williams <https://www.wikitree.com/g2g/user/Williams-49144> got their spit kit within the next couple of days while I didn't get anything. I was very patiently waiting and reached out to them only 14 days after the order. I was told by Paul from Dante Labs that: "during our Black Friday Special Week, we had many more orders than expected. As a result, some orders have been delayed." Today is 14th of December and I still haven't even received an email notification that the spit kit is on the way. So it hasn't left their office, as they claim this is their standard process. I have therefore demanded that my order is cancelled and I get my money back. Let's see how that customer experience will work as so far this has been a very, very disappointing experience. In my feedback on the 4th of December I've told them that I'd expect that spit kits are send out in the order they have received them. So first customer gets the spit kit first. Clearly that wasn't the case for me. For transparency, I've ordered on 18th of November 2018 at 10:51PM (22:51) in the GMT+7 timezone. Given that their price was way below the usual cost for a FGS DNA test and most likely their profit is very small, if they make one at all, I'd rather would like my money back as it seems they aren't able to fulfill those customer orders. For the record, I never had such a negative experience on any sales offer with 23andMe, FTDNA or Ancestry from whom I've bought DNA tests before. That's interesting. It certainly looks like equivalent results were achieved. I'm not familiar with Ion Torrent -- I wonder how it would compare with Illumina in detecting heteroplasmy. This is unrelated news, but Ion Torrent is a product of Thermo Fisher Scientific. LivingDNA has just switched to a new chip made by Affymetrix, acquired by Thermo Fisher a couple of years ago. The problem here is how to create a synthetic kit that will be acceptable to FTDNA. We don't know what kind of "sanity checks" FTDNA used when rejecting Doug's files, perhaps too much homozygosity. A typical file would have about 70% homozygous SNPs, so Doug needs to introduce some spurious heterozygous SNPs that would never generate a false match.
